How do I add local sources to Tachiyomi? Since v0. 5.0, Tachiyomi supports local manga. You have to place your manga inside the folder Tachiyomi/local located in the root of your internal storage or external SD card, usually /sdcard and /storage/18F5-2C11 (with different values). After that, they will be shown in the catalogue as a new source.

What does Tachiyomi symbol mean?

“Tachiyomi” literally means “standing reading” and describes the practice of going to a bookshop and standing there reading the magazines or books.

How do I transfer my Tachiyomi library?

  • Tap into. explore. …
  • Press the Migrate tab at the top next to Extensions .
  • Select the Source that you’d like to migrate from.
  • Tap the Manga you’d like to migrate from the Source. …
  • Select the Source you’d like to migrate to by tapping the Manga thumbnail.
  • Choose which data you want to transfer over, and you’re done.

How do I add more extensions to Tachiyomi?

Installing an extension. Browse and then switch to the Extensions tab. Find the extension that you’d like to use then press the INSTALL button next to your desired extension and then accept the installation prompt. You might need to give Tachiyomi the permission to install unknown apps, you can read how to do so here.

Why is my Tachiyomi slow?

Tachiyomi is not hosting any content, we are not affiliated with or responsible for any source that is; slow, down, missing chapters, or has subpar image quality. If any sources are slow, it is likely due to the site being slow, your internet being slow, or a ratelimit applied to the source to reduce load or IP bans.

What is Tachiyomi Japan?

‘Tachiyomi’ in Japanese translates to ‘standing reading’. This term came about because of the widely accepted practice in Japanese culture to stand and read magazines or books inside of the many bookstores one can find across Japan.

Why is Tachiyomi not on Play Store?

Will Tachiyomi ever be on the Google Play Store? Google Play’s content policy does not allow the APK based extension system to work.
